Peet’s Coffee, Dark and Medium Roast Espresso Capsules
- ✓ Rich, aromatic flavors
- ✓ Compatibility with multiple Nespresso models
- ✓ Eco-friendly recyclable capsules
- ✕ Slightly higher price point
- ✕ Not compatible with Vertuo machines
| Capsule Material | Aluminum, recyclable via mail-back program |
| Capsule Compatibility | Nespresso Original Machines (Essenza Mini, Essenza Plus, Pixie, CitiZ, Lattissima, KitchenAid, Creatista); not compatible with Vertuo machines |
| Number of Capsules | 40 capsules total (4 boxes of 10 each) |
| Roast Levels | Medium and dark roasts (Ricchezza, Crema Scura, Ristretto, Nerissimo) |
| Brew Size Compatibility | Ristretto (0.85 oz / 25 ml) and Espresso (1.35 oz / 40 ml) |
| Flavor Profiles | Berry and brown sugar, luscious crema, spice and chocolate, bittersweet indulgence |
